Additional Tips for a Memorable Visit
To enhance your visit to Machu Picchu, consider these expert tips for an unforgettable experience amidst the ancient citadel’s wonders.
Best Photography Spots: Capture stunning shots at the Guardhouse, Intihuatana Stone, and the Sun Gate for breathtaking views of Machu Picchu. Don’t miss the classic shot of the llamas grazing with the citadel in the background.
Local Cuisine Suggestions: Indulge in traditional Peruvian dishes at the Tinkuy Buffet Restaurant near the entrance. Try specialties like ceviche, lomo saltado, and quinoa soup for an authentic taste of the region.
Exploration Tips: Venture off the beaten path to discover hidden gems within Machu Picchu. Visit the Inca Bridge and the Temple of the Moon for lesser-known but equally impressive sights.
Timing Recommendations: Arrive early to avoid crowds and witness the sunrise over the ancient ruins for a magical start to your Machu Picchu adventure.
